Robert Parker's Wine Advocate

Tasting L'Ermita is always an emotional moment, as it's one of the great reds from Spain. The 2015 L'Ermita is 91 Garnacha, 8 Carinena and 1 split between Garnacha Blanca, Macabeo and PX from the most famous single vineyard in Priorat. It fermented in oak foudre with indigenous yeasts and also had its elevage in foudre, which lasted for 15 months. The juicy freshness of this 2015, citric and vibrant, makes it very different from the rest of the portfolio. This is transparent, precise, like laser cut, chiseled, subtle and elegant, showing very open and expressive, with great freshness and the core of Mediterranean flavors. 2,200 bottles were filled in February 2017.

Wine Spectator

JS Aromas of blueberry, purple fruits, violet petal, blue slate ... moss. Full body yet compacted and compressed with amazing mouthfeel of fine-grained tannins. Structured yet superbly balanced making it so attractive now. 2,300 bottles made. Drink or hold.
